1、mysql怎么创建触发器_创建触发器的语句
MySQL触发器通过事件触发执行,支持多种操作类型,提供数据完整性保护。
2、MySQL触发器的基础概念是什么?
触发器是一种特殊存储过程,通过事件触发执行,确保数据操作的完整性和一致性。
3、MySQL触发器的定义与作用是什么?
触发器通过数据表操作自动执行,确保数据一致性、日志记录和数据校验等功能。
4、MySQL触发器的工作机制是什么?
触发器基于事件驱动,支持在数据操作前后执行,实现业务规则和数据完整性检查。
5、如何编写MySQL创建触发器的语句?
创建触发器需使用CREATE TRIGGER语句,指定触发时机、事件和执行操作。
6、MySQL创建触发器的基本语法是什么?
基本语法包括CREATE TRIGGER、触发时机、事件类型和执行体,确保数据操作的一致性。
7、MySQL触发器中的触发事件与触发时机有哪些?
触发事件包括INSERT、UPDATE、DELETE,时机可选在事件前后,确保操作的实时性。
8、MySQL触发器可以执行哪些操作?
触发器可执行数据更新、日志记录、发送通知等多种操作,增强数据库管理能力。
9、如何具体创建MySQL触发器?
创建触发器需明确名称、时机、事件和操作,确保数据库操作的自动化和一致性。
10、如何定义MySQL触发器的名称与时机?
触发器名称需唯一,时机可选BEFORE或AFTER,确保操作在事件前后执行。
11、如何为MySQL触发器指定触发事件?
指定触发事件为INSERT、UPDATE或DELETE,确保触发器在特定操作时激活。
12、如何编写MySQL触发器要执行的操作?
编写触发器操作时,需明确执行语句,支持单条或多条语句,确保逻辑完整性。
13、MySQL触发器的应用场景有哪些?
触发器可用于数据完整性保护、日志记录、自动化任务和数据监控等多种场景。
14、如何利用MySQL触发器进行数据完整性保护?
通过触发器监控数据变化,自动执行检查和修复操作,确保数据完整性。
15、如何使用MySQL触发器自动更新数据?
使用触发器在数据更新时记录新旧值,确保数据变化的完整记录和跟踪。
16、如何利用MySQL触发器实现业务逻辑的自动化处理?
通过绑定特定表操作,触发器可自动化处理复杂业务逻辑,提升系统效率。
17、MySQL触发器常见问题及解决方案有哪些?
常见问题包括语法错误、依赖失效等,需检查语法、依赖和权限设置。
18、为什么MySQL触发器无法正常触发?如何解决?
检查触发器是否启用及条件满足情况,确保事件发生时能正常激活。
19、MySQL触发器对性能的影响是什么?如何解决?
触发器可能影响性能,需优化逻辑和减少冗余操作以提高系统效率。
20、MySQL触发器中的错误处理机制是什么?
触发器支持错误处理机制,通过自定义错误代码和条件处理提升系统可靠性。
21、如何有效使用和管理MySQL中的触发器?
触发器通过自动化执行确保数据一致性,实时反应适用于复杂业务逻辑处理。
22、如何在MySQL中创建和删除触发器?
使用CREATE TRIGGER语句创建触发器,结合事件触发操作,删除时用DROP TRIGGER语句。
23、如何对MySQL中的触发器进行维护和优化?
定期检查触发器性能,优化代码结构,确保其在高效执行中保持数据一致性。